Description
nylon fiber rope is made of advanced multifilament fibers. These fibers are tightly woven or woven, with excellent durability, greater load-bearing capacity, and better elasticity. Advanced weaving technology enables nylon synthetic ropes to perform well under extreme pressure.
One of the main advantages of nylon synthetic fiber rope is its enhanced strength to weight ratio. It has greater tensile strength. In addition, its multifilament structure provides better elasticity, allowing the rope to effectively absorb impact loads. This makes it an ideal choice for dynamic operations such as mooring, towing, and lifting.
Feature
- Density: 1.14g/cm3
- Melting point: 215℃
- Elongation: 14%-25%
- Abrasion resistance: excellent
- UV resistance: good
- Chemical resistance: good
Application
nylon fiber rope is widely used in heavy-duty operations, such as ocean mooring lines, towing cables, industrial lifting, and rescue operations. Their ability to absorb energy and resist environmental pressure makes them the preferred choice in scenarios that require safety and reliability.
Technical Data
Nylon Ropes
| Size | Weight | MBL | |||
|---|---|---|---|---|---|
| Dia.mm | Cir.inch | g/m | kgs/220m | kN | ton |
| 40 | 5 | 1040 | 229 | 304 | 31 |
| 44 | 5-1/2 | 1250 | 275 | 412 | 42 |
| 48 | 6 | 1480 | 326 | 490 | 50 |
| 52 | 6-1/2 | 1640 | 361 | 531 | 54.2 |
| 56 | 7 | 2000 | 440 | 651 | 66.4 |
| 60 | 7-1/2 | 2160 | 475 | 686 | 70 |
| 62 | 7-3/4 | 2350 | 517 | 784 | 80 |
| 64 | 8 | 2450 | 539 | 795 | 81.1 |
| 68 | 8-1/2 | 2810 | 619 | 925 | 94.4 |
| 70 | 8-3/4 | 3110 | 684 | 1010 | 103 |
| 72 | 9 | 3250 | 715 | 1040 | 106.1 |
| 78 | 9-3/4 | 3770 | 829 | 1180 | 120.4 |
| 84 | 10-1/2 | 4270 | 939 | 1380 | 141 |
| 90 | 11-1/4 | 5040 | 1109 | 1620 | 165.3 |
| 96 | 12 | 5860 | 1289 | 1870 | 191 |
